Beech Grove was not able to break out of their rough patch on Monday as the team picked up their seventh straight defeat. They came up short against the Southport Cardinals, falling 3-0.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Hornets of the 3-0 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in September of 2024.
The match finished with set scores of 25-13, 25-13, 25-12.
Leading Southport to victory were Maddie Pfeiffer and Lily Boone. Pfeiffer had six digs and four aces, while Boone had 13 digs and two assists. Boone has been hot, having posted 12 or more digs the last eight times she's played. Vanthapar Kho also deserves some recognition as she served her first ace of the season.
Beech Grove's defeat dropped their record down to 2-19. As for Southport, their win ended a four-game drought at home and bumped them up to 10-9.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Beech Grove will venture away from home to face off against Pike at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Southport, they will head out to challenge Whiteland at 6:30 p.m. on Wednesday.
